Fedora 23: pgpdump Security Advisory - CVE-2016-4021 Critical Loop Issue

CVE-2016-4021 pgpdump: endless loop parsing specially crafted input.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Fedora Update Notification FEDORA-2016-5733ad20f5 2016-05-10 11:45:44.977591 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Name : pgpdump Product : Fedora 23 Version : 0.30 Release : 1.fc23 URL : http://www.mew.org/~kazu/proj/pgpdump/ Summary : PGP packet visualizer Description : pgpdump is a PGP packet visualizer which displays the packet format of OpenPGP (RFC 4880) and PGP version 2 (RFC 1991). -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Update Information: CVE-2016-4021 pgpdump: endless loop parsing specially crafted input -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- References: [ 1 ] Bug #1328351 - CVE-2016-4021 pgpdump: endless loop parsing specially crafted input https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1328351 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- This update can be installed with the "yum" update program. Use su -c 'yum update pgpdump' at the command line. For more information, refer to "Managing Software with yum", available at . All packages are signed with the Fedora Project GPG key. Arch Linux: ASA-201604-11 Low Severity: pgpdump DoS Attack

The package pgpdump before version 0.30-1 is vulnerable to denial of service. . Arch Linux Security Advisory ASA-201604-11 ========================================= Severity: Low Date : 2016-04-22 CVE-ID : CVE-2016-4021 Package : pgpdump Type : denial of service Remote : Yes Link : https://wiki.archlinux.org/title/CVE Summary ====== The package pgpdump before version 0.30-1 is vulnerable to denial of service. Resolution ========= Upgrade to 0.30-1. # pacman -Syu "pgpdump> =0.30-1" The problem has been fixed upstream in version 0.30. Workaround ========= None. Description ========== When pgpdump is run on specially crafted input, a denial of service condition occurs. The program runs with 100% CPU usage for an indefinite amount of time. This can be abused in scenarios where users can supply input to pgpdump, e.g. in http://www.pgpdump.net/. Impact ===== A remote attacker is able to create a specially crafted input that is leading to CPU resource consumption resulting in denial of service.
